
SpringBoot中MybatisPlus代码生成器使用详解
下载需积分: 12 | 18KB |
更新于2024-11-23
| 194 浏览量 | 举报
收藏
该生成器支持的版本为mybatis-plus-generator 3.5.1及以上,提供了详细的注释,让开发者能够清楚地了解每个配置项的具体作用,并且指出了在使用时需要根据实际情况进行修改的地方。本资源涉及的知识点包括SpringBoot、MybatisPlus以及代码生成器的使用和配置,适用于Java后端开发人员。"
知识点:
1. SpringBoot项目理解:
SpringBoot是一个用于简化Spring应用的初始搭建以及开发过程的框架。它使用了特定的方式来配置Spring,使得开发者可以几乎不用配置或编写样板化的代码就能开发和运行一个Spring应用。SpringBoot可以用来创建独立的、生产级别的Spring基础的应用程序。
2. MybatisPlus概述:
MybatisPlus是在Mybatis的基础上提供增强功能的工具,目的是简化开发、提高效率。MybatisPlus提供了一些自动化的CRUD操作和一些高级特性,如通用的CRUD接口、分页插件、逻辑删除等。它旨在减少代码编写,提高开发效率,尤其适合用于中大型项目。
3. MybatisPlus代码生成器作用:
MybatisPlus代码生成器可以自动生成包括Mapper、Service、ServiceImpl、实体类(Entity)等在内的多个基础代码文件。这些自动生成的代码可以让开发者省去编写样板代码的时间,让开发者可以更加专注于业务逻辑的实现。
4. 代码生成器配置细节:
配置生成器时需要指定一些关键的参数,如数据源配置、包路径、作者信息、表名和生成策略等。详细注释的配置能够帮助开发者理解每个配置项的作用,确保生成器能够根据实际需求生成相应的代码结构。
5. SpringBoot与MybatisPlus整合:
在SpringBoot项目中整合MybatisPlus,首先需要添加MybatisPlus的依赖,然后配置数据源、SqlSessionFactory、Mapper扫描等组件。SpringBoot与MybatisPlus的整合能够提供自动配置支持,使得整个项目的搭建和运行更为简便。
6. mybatis-plus-generator版本要求:
在使用MybatisPlus代码生成器时,需要确保所使用的MybatisPlus版本为3.5.1及以上。版本兼容性是使用该工具前需要关注的一个重要方面,确保不同组件之间的兼容可以避免许多潜在的错误。
7. 修改提示及自定义:
生成器的配置往往需要根据实际的项目需求进行修改。例如,数据库连接信息、包名前缀、表名等配置项可能需要根据具体的数据库结构和项目结构进行调整。在使用时,需要特别关注这些需要修改的地方,以确保代码生成后能够与项目顺利集成。
通过以上知识点的介绍,开发者可以对MybatisPlus代码生成器有一个全面的认识,并能够在自己的SpringBoot项目中有效地利用它,以提高开发效率和项目开发的自动化程度。
相关推荐



















_秋牧
- 粉丝: 107
最新资源
- 中国建设银行详细介绍文档
- ZZ-05转正审批汇签单详细流程及主管职责
- pexports-0.44:DLL转库工具的更新与优化
- 城镇地籍调查规程解析与应用
- Bandizip便携版实现右键注册教程
- C#入门案例:windowforms人事档案管理系统
- 获取Firefox火狐浏览器官方84.0.1-win64版安装包
- 保洁日检查表文档下载及重要性解析
- OpenSSL命令行工具:加密与密钥证书管理
- 房地产REITs应用研究深入分析
- 速达3000V8.13DJ补丁安装及破解方法
- 掌握重大交易类别与披露流程及其IT应用
- Java开发的SSH OA办公系统源码下载
- GM200鼠标驱动安装与宏操作指南
- 小学生语文学习打卡小程序开发实战
- 黑莓手机bar安装包的Windows系统运行文件解析
- 达梦数据库7 JDBC驱动下载指南
- VB.NET开发的电子时钟程序实例教程
- 博通broadcom BCM5709/5716/5722网卡驱动程序最新版
- 调幅发射机电路设计原理与实践
- 合伙人股权机制全解析:进入与退出策略
- 采购管理系统设计与开发教程
- FR-CL0104特殊事项说明文档
- FR-AQ0111监控中心电话记录表详细分析